/**
* Integration test for round-trip generation and parsing
* This test ensures that data can be generated to SHAAM format and parsed back correctly
*/
import { describe, expect, it } from 'vitest';
import { generateUniformFormatReport } from '../../src/api/generate-report';
import {
parseA100,
parseB100,
parseB110,
parseC100,
parseD110,
parseD120,
parseM100,
parseZ900,
} from '../../src/generator/records/index';
import type { ReportInput } from '../../src/types/index';
describe('SHAAM Format Round-trip Integration Test', () => {
it('should generate and parse back a complete report', () => {
// Full ReportInput fixture
const input: ReportInput = {
business: {
businessId: '12345',
name: 'Test Company Ltd',
taxId: '123456789',
reportingPeriod: {
startDate: '2024-01-01',
endDate: '2024-12-31',
},
},
documents: [
{
id: 'DOC001',
type: '320', // Invoice
date: '2024-03-15',
amount: 1000.5,
description: 'Consulting services',
},
{
id: 'DOC002',
type: '330', // Credit memo
date: '2024-03-20',
amount: 250.75,
description: 'Product return',
},
],
journalEntries: [
{
id: 'JE001',
date: '2024-03-15',
amount: 1000.5,
accountId: '1100',
description: 'Sales revenue',
},
{
id: 'JE002',
date: '2024-03-20',
amount: -250.75,
accountId: '1200',
description: 'Returns and allowances',
},
],
accounts: [
{
id: '1100',
name: 'Cash',
type: 'Asset',
balance: 5000.0,
},
{
id: '1200',
name: 'Accounts Receivable',
type: 'Asset',
balance: 3000.0,
},
{
id: '4000',
name: 'Sales Revenue',
type: 'Revenue',
balance: 8000.0,
},
],
inventory: [
{
id: 'ITEM001',
name: 'Product A',
quantity: 100,
unitPrice: 25.0,
},
{
id: 'ITEM002',
name: 'Product B',
quantity: 50,
unitPrice: 45.0,
},
],
};
// Generate the report
const result = generateUniformFormatReport(input);
expect(result).toBeDefined();
expect(result.dataText).toBeDefined();
expect(result.iniText).toBeDefined();
expect(result.summary.totalRecords).toBeGreaterThan(0);
// Split dataText into lines and parse each record
const lines = result.dataText.split('\r\n').filter(line => line.trim().length > 0);
interface ParsedData {
businessMetadata: ReturnType<typeof parseA100> | null;
documents: ReturnType<typeof parseC100>[];
documentLines: ReturnType<typeof parseD110>[];
payments: ReturnType<typeof parseD120>[];
journalEntries: ReturnType<typeof parseB100>[];
accounts: ReturnType<typeof parseB110>[];
inventory: ReturnType<typeof parseM100>[];
closingRecord: ReturnType<typeof parseZ900> | null;
}
const parsedData: ParsedData = {
businessMetadata: null,
documents: [],
documentLines: [],
payments: [],
journalEntries: [],
accounts: [],
inventory: [],
closingRecord: null,
};
// Parse each line based on record type
for (const line of lines) {
const recordType = line.substring(0, 4);
switch (recordType) {
case 'A100':
parsedData.businessMetadata = parseA100(line);
break;
case 'C100':
parsedData.documents.push(parseC100(line));
break;
case 'D110':
parsedData.documentLines.push(parseD110(line));
break;
case 'D120':
parsedData.payments.push(parseD120(line));
break;
case 'B100':
parsedData.journalEntries.push(parseB100(line));
break;
case 'B110':
parsedData.accounts.push(parseB110(line));
break;
case 'M100':
parsedData.inventory.push(parseM100(line));
break;
case 'Z900':
parsedData.closingRecord = parseZ900(line);
break;
default:
// Unknown record type, skip silently for test purposes
break;
}
}
// Verify business metadata
expect(parsedData.businessMetadata).toBeDefined();
expect(parsedData.businessMetadata?.vatId).toBe(input.business.taxId);
// primaryIdentifier is now auto-generated, so just verify it's a valid 15-digit string
expect(parsedData.businessMetadata?.primaryIdentifier).toMatch(/^\d{15}$/);
// Verify documents
expect(parsedData.documents).toHaveLength(input.documents.length);
for (let i = 0; i < input.documents.length; i++) {
const original = input.documents[i];
const parsed = parsedData.documents[i];
expect(parsed.documentId).toBe(original.id);
expect(parsed.documentType).toBe(original.type);
expect(parsed.documentIssueDate).toBe(original.date.replace(/-/g, ''));
}
// Verify document lines
expect(parsedData.documentLines).toHaveLength(input.documents.length);
for (let i = 0; i < input.documents.length; i++) {
const original = input.documents[i];
const parsed = parsedData.documentLines[i];
expect(parsed.documentNumber).toBe(original.id);
expect(parsed.documentType).toBe(original.type);
expect(parsed.goodsServiceDescription).toBe(original.description || 'Item');
}
// Verify payments
expect(parsedData.payments).toHaveLength(input.documents.length);
for (let i = 0; i < input.documents.length; i++) {
const original = input.documents[i];
const parsed = parsedData.payments[i];
expect(parsed.documentNumber).toBe(original.id);
expect(parsed.documentType).toBe(original.type);
expect(parsed.lineAmount).toBe(original.amount.toFixed(2));
}
// Verify journal entries
expect(parsedData.journalEntries).toHaveLength(input.journalEntries.length);
for (let i = 0; i < input.journalEntries.length; i++) {
const original = input.journalEntries[i];
const parsed = parsedData.journalEntries[i];
const expectedTransactionNumber =
(original.id.replace(/\D/g, '') || '1').replace(/^0+/, '') || '0';
expect(parsed.transactionNumber).toBe(expectedTransactionNumber); // Numeric part with leading zeros stripped
expect(parsed.accountKey).toBe(original.accountId);
expect(parsed.transactionAmount).toBe(Math.abs(original.amount).toFixed(2));
expect(parsed.debitCreditIndicator).toBe(original.amount >= 0 ? '1' : '2');
}
// Verify accounts
expect(parsedData.accounts).toHaveLength(input.accounts.length);
for (let i = 0; i < input.accounts.length; i++) {
const original = input.accounts[i];
const parsed = parsedData.accounts[i];
expect(parsed.accountKey).toBe(original.id);
expect(parsed.accountName).toBe(original.name);
expect(parsed.trialBalanceCode).toBe(original.type);
}
// Verify inventory
expect(parsedData.inventory).toHaveLength(input.inventory.length);
for (let i = 0; i < input.inventory.length; i++) {
const original = input.inventory[i];
const parsed = parsedData.inventory[i];
expect(parsed.internalItemCode).toBe(original.id);
expect(parsed.itemName).toBe(original.name);
expect(parsed.totalStockOut).toBe(original.quantity.toString());
}
// Verify closing record
expect(parsedData.closingRecord).toBeDefined();
expect(parsedData.closingRecord?.vatId).toBe(input.business.taxId);
// uniqueId is now auto-generated and should match the primaryIdentifier
expect(parsedData.closingRecord?.uniqueId).toMatch(/^\d{15}$/);
expect(parsedData.closingRecord?.uniqueId).toBe(parsedData.businessMetadata?.primaryIdentifier);
expect(parseInt(parsedData.closingRecord?.totalRecords || '0')).toBeGreaterThan(0);
// Verify summary record counts match parsed data
const expectedTotalRecords =
1 + // A000 (INI file)
8 + // A000Sum records (one for each record type: A100, C100, D110, D120, B100, B110, M100, Z900)
1 + // A100
input.documents.length + // C100 records
input.documents.length + // D110 records
input.documents.length + // D120 records
input.journalEntries.length + // B100 records
input.accounts.length + // B110 records
input.inventory.length + // M100 records
1; // Z900
expect(result.summary.totalRecords).toBe(expectedTotalRecords);
expect(parseInt(parsedData.closingRecord?.totalRecords || '0')).toBe(expectedTotalRecords - 10); // Z900 counts data records only (excludes A000, A000Sum records, and Z900 itself)
// Verify record type counts in summary
expect(result.summary.perType.A000).toBe(1);
expect(result.summary.perType.A100).toBe(1);
expect(result.summary.perType.C100).toBe(input.documents.length);
expect(result.summary.perType.D110).toBe(input.documents.length);
expect(result.summary.perType.D120).toBe(input.documents.length);
expect(result.summary.perType.B100).toBe(input.journalEntries.length);
expect(result.summary.perType.B110).toBe(input.accounts.length);
expect(result.summary.perType.M100).toBe(input.inventory.length);
expect(result.summary.perType.Z900).toBe(1);
});
